3. Key Elements of a Successful Dispensary Build-Out
A dispensary build-out requires attention to several important factors:
a. Space Planning
A logical, well-planned layout improves both customer experience and staff workflow.
b. Compliance
Dispensaries must follow rules related to surveillance, entry processes, accessibility, and secure storage areas.
c. Material Selection
Durable, easy-to-maintain materials help maintain a clean and professional environment.
d. Technology Setup
Security cameras, check-in points, display screens, and POS systems must be planned during the design phase for smooth installation.
